Led by a historian and designed by a former Guardsman, this walking tour is the best way to see the Changing of the Guard ceremony. You’ll get historical context, insider knowledge and great vantage points. You’ll also walk alongside the New and Old Guards as they march along The Mall. If you are wondering, it is as exciting as it sounds.

You’ll see Buckingham Palace, of course, but you’ll also visit St James’s Palace and Clarence House, and understand how these royal residences fit into this world-famous ceremony. If we’re lucky (it sometimes happens), you might even catch a glimpse of the King and Queen.

    Wellington Barracks

    This immense Georgian barracks is where the Changing of the Guard both begins and ends, and we will be here to see the new Guard come on duty.

    15 minutes Admission ticket free
  • Clarence House (Pass by)

    Your Changing of the Guard experience concludes outside Clarence House, the home of the King and Queen - which is just a couple of minutes away from Buckingham Palace. It will also be a final opportunity to see the Guards and the ceremonial band, and we are likely to see the Horse Guards as well.
